We are looking to recruit a Procurement Manager to join our non Clinical IT Team and our Clinical Sourcing Team to provide a customer centric service to drive the sourcing of value for money products and services to support the delivery of high quality clinical care to our patients.
The successful candidates will have the flexibility to be based at either in Royal United Hospitals in Bath, Salisbury NHS Foundation Trust or Great Western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ust in Swindon.
Main duties of the job
The non clinical role will cover Informatics and Corporate Services Category - from sourcing through to contract management.
The procurement manager in this role will be required to maintain a personal knowledge base, which reflects current research and development, and disseminate information, where appropriate. The post holder will develop and maintain relationships with clinical colleagues to ensure that patient safety is ensured and risks are minimised through best practice and by the procurement of products that are evidenced based. Through the development of these relationships the procurement manager will liaise with decision makers and end-users to help identify new schemes in pursuit of cost reduction objectives.
